SUMMARY

Mareks disease is a form of cancer of poultry caused by an important herpesvirus (MDV). It continues to be a threat to poultry health and welfare and worldwide losses are estimated to be US$ 1 billion annually. This book provides a timely review of the problems of Marek's disease with descriptions of the complex viral life cycle, how MDV targets different types of white blood cells, and details of the virus structure, its genes and proteins.Davison, Fred is the author of 'Marek's Disease An Evolving Problem', published 2004 under ISBN 9780120883790 and ISBN 0120883791.
